Fruit Pizza With Coconut Whipped Topping
Print Recipe
Ingredients
- Sugar Cookie Dough or this gluten free dough
Coconut Whipped Cream
- 2 Cups Fresh Fruit of your choice; We used Strawberries & Blueberries
- shredded coconut optional
Instructions
-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. Roll out and shape cookie dough into a large pizza circle. You may only need half of your dough. Bake 16 to 20 minutes or until golden brown. Cool completely, about 30 minutes.
- Once completely cool, use a spatula to spread the coconut whipped cream over the top of the cookie crust.
- Top the pizza with the fresh fruit of your choice and sprinkle with the shredded coconut (optional).
- SERVE

TIPS
- Do not assemble pizza until ready to serve. The whipped topping can make the crust soggy.
